September 2010 Keynote Program
Managing the Company Expectation to Generate Recordable Savings
Does the pressure to deliver consistent value savings interfere with the
requirement to maintain a reliable supply chain? Two of Houston’s leading
Supply Chain leaders discuss the balancing act of meeting company
expectations in both areas

John V. Adams
Vice President, Supply Chain & Chief Procurement Officer
Spectra Energy Transmission
John Adams is vice president, supply chain for Spectra Energy Transmission.
He is responsible for material and services sourcing and procurement, fleet
services, accounts payable, expense card program administration and related
supply chain governance activities.
Adams joined Spectra Energy’s predecessor company Panhandle Eastern in
1981. Following a series of promotions, he was named director of transmission
services, and continued to hold positions of increasing responsibility including:
Houston division manager for Trunkline Gas; general manager of gas systems
for Northeast pipelines; division manager of the south division for Texas
Eastern Transmission; and environment, health and safety (EHS) vice
president for Duke Energy Gas Transmission.
Adams continued as EHS vice president after the company’s spin-off from Duke
Energy in 2007 and was named to his current position in November 2008.
Born in Xenia, Ohio, Adams received a Bachelor of Science in industrial
management from Purdue University and attended the Advanced Management
Program at Duke University.

Abid Yousuf
Vice President,
Supply Chain Management
Enterprise Products Partners
Abid Yousuf joined Enterprise Products Partners in September, 2004 as
Director of the Strategic Sourcing and Procurement group. His current
responsibilities include: contract management, procurement, strategic
sourcing, business process improvement, energy optimization, fleet
management and materials management. Prior to Enterprise, he led
the Global Account Management group at Ariba, Inc., a leading provider
of procurement technology and consulting services.
Prior to this role, Abid served at CNG Company (now Dominion Resources)
in Pittsburgh where he was responsible for managing and controlling the
company’s energy derivatives portfolio. He also worked with CNG’s gas and
oil transmission group during his tenure at CNG. Abid holds a Masters degree
in Business Administration from the University of Pittsburgh and a Bachelors
degree in Business Economics from the University of Notre Dame, in Indiana.
